Texas has made significant investments in solar and wind energy, contributing to its status as a renewable energy capital in the U.S. The state has added approximately 9,700 megawatts of solar and 4,374 megawatts of battery storage in 2024, surpassing other energy sources in new generation capacity. These investments are expected to generate over $20 billion in total tax revenue and $29.5 billion in payments to landowners over the projects' lifetimes. The growth of renewables has been a significant source of revenue for local jurisdictions and landowners across Texas, with over 75% of Texas counties expected to receive tax revenues from these projects.

The last 50 years have seen a significant increase in extreme weather events worldwide, driven by climate change and more extreme weather patterns. Here are some key points highlighting this increase:
- Increased frequency and intensity: The frequency and intensity of extreme weather events have increased, with more heatwaves, droughts, and forest fires observed in recent years.
1- Global impact: These extreme weather events have disproportionately impacted poorer countries, with over 91% of the deaths occurring in developing nations.
1- Economic losses: Economic losses from climate and weather disasters have also increased, with a sevenfold increase over the past five decades.
1- Improved early warnings: Thanks to improved early warning systems and disaster management, the number of deaths from these disasters has decreased almost threefold between 1970 and 2019.
